Is Spotify API Free?

The Spotify API is a powerful tool for developers and music lovers alike. It allows users to access their favorite songs and playlists, as well as to create new ones.

The API also provides access to a wide range of other music-related information and services, including radio stations, recommendations, artist-related data and more.

The Spotify API is incredibly versatile, with a range of features that can be used to create powerful applications. For example, developers can use the API to find specific songs or artists, get recommendations based on user preferences and even create custom playlists. Additionally, the API can be used to provide social features such as sharing playlists or discovering new music.

One of the most attractive aspects of the Spotify API is its availability for free. While there are some premium features available for purchase, the majority of the content available via the API is free for use by developers.

This makes it an ideal choice for those who want to develop apps without having to pay for expensive licensing fees.
